Serving 239 students in grades Prekindergarten-6, Joseph Sibilly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Virgin Islands for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 75-79% (which is lower than the Virgin Islands state average of 89%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 55-59% (which is lower than the Virgin Islands state average of 75%).
The student:teacher ratio of 16:1 is higher than the Virgin Islands state level of 12:1.
Minority enrollment is 92% of the student body (majority Black), which is lower than the Virgin Islands state average of 99% (majority Black).
Serving 459 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Joseph Gomez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Virgin Islands for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 90% (which is higher than the Virgin Islands state average of 89%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 82% (which is higher than the Virgin Islands state average of 75%).
The student:teacher ratio of 11:1 is lower than the Virgin Islands state level of 12:1.
